Travel Tips

Transport

By far the most economical and private method of family transport in Bali is Rideshare services Gojek or Grab. A little hack you may want to use is using booking.com to book your ride, but please be aware; booking your transportation this way is most suitable when planning ahead, most especially when travelling longer distances, like to or from the airport. When doing so, you will see your name written on a sign (normally piece of paper!) as soon as you walk outside from the arrivals terminal. Be aware, it can get a bit crazy walking outside when there’s lots of drivers wanting you in their cars.

Another upside with Gojek and Grab is that you can order inexpensive healthy, locally-made, home delivered food if you’re wanting a bit of a snack.

Communication

The number-one platform for digital communication in Bali is via WhatsApp. This way, you can chat and organise whatever you need to without losing your phone number.

Titi Batu

Titi Batu Ubud Club
Ubud’s premier family-friendly Community, Sport, and Wellness Club, purpose-built for all ages to enjoy. With its relaxed yet vibrant atmosphere, you’ll find an array of activities for everyone. From Pilates, dance, and fitness classes to kids’ acrobatics, capoeira, and swimming lessons, there’s something to suit every interest. The club also features a sauna, cold plunge, skate park, basketball courts, and a large swimming pool with plenty of cabana lounges for unwinding.

For families, Titi Batu offers various kids’ workshops throughout the week, capped off with their legendary Sunday bouncy castle and foam party!

Zest Ubud is a unique place, not only because of the delicious vegetarian and vegan food, but because of the energy and beauty of the place. It also has an open space surrounded by temples where beautiful artists offer incredible concerts. While it isn’t purpose-built to cater to families, at only 1.5 kms from Ubud’s town centre, many families frequent Zest for it’s chill atmosphere away from the hustle and bustle of inner Ubud.

Tulus Hati

Tulus Hati, the private boutique retreat, translates to “sincere pure heart.” Designed with intention, this serene haven embodies peace, safety, and comfort. Its circular layout symbolises a mother’s womb—a space for new beginnings and personal growth. Often hosting yoga and holistic wellness retreats, Tulus Hati offers an idyllic setting to relax and recharge during your five child-free days. Enjoy a healthy buffet breakfast, send the kids to school on the shuttle bus, and indulge in yoga, breath-work, meditation, or a soothing massage. You can also unwind by the pool or explore Ubud’s vibrant surroundings using our curated Top Ten for inspiration.

With exclusive use of the entire site during your stay, families can connect in a supportive and uninterrupted environment. Accommodation options include comfortably sized, self-contained rooms with private bathrooms:

  • 7 Villaswith a king-sized bed that can be converted into two king singles (with the option to add up to 2 extra single beds per villa).
  • 1 Triple Roomwith three single beds (with the option to add up to 2 extra single beds, subject to a small additional fee).

Facilities

  • Large swimming pool and cabana lounges nestled in lush surroundings
  • Peaceful, secure, and gated site with a full perimeter wall
  • Private alfresco bathrooms in every room
  • Spacious upstairs communal activity area overlooking rice paddies
  • On-site alfresco café-restaurant
  • Support and information from Tulus Hati staff
  • 5 km / 2.8 mi from Empathy School
  • 5 km / 3.4 mi to Ubud town centre
  • 43 km / 26.7 mi to Ngurah Rai International Airport
